Web2 nov. 2024 · Full-time equivalents (FTEs) is a metric used to show you what your total labor hours equates to in full-time employees. Part-time employees are included as a fraction of one FTE based on how much they work. Business use FTEs to measure performance, plan labor, and for certain regulations under the ACA. FTE is used in the calculation of a number of indicators included in the IPEDS Data Feedback Report and the IPEDS Use the Data portal. FTE is estimated from the total credit hours attempted over the full 12-month period of July 1st through June 30th. The formula looks like this: Scheduled work hours / company's full-time working hours per week. Web19 okt. 2024 · Most industries define FTE as the total number of full time equivalent employees. Academia uses that definition, but it has a second one too: full time equivalent students. Suppose your college has 10,000 students attending full time and another 4,000 going for half the year. That translates into 12,000 FTE students. graphic feature meaning
